What Is Sewer Camera Inspection?
Sewer camera inspection is the use of a small, waterproof HD camera on a flexible cable run through your sewer line. It shows blockages, root intrusion, bellies (sags), breaks, and other damage. In Las Vegas, caliche soil and tree roots make these issues common. Recorded footage is useful for real estate, insurance, and repair planning.

Las Vegas has caliche soil and shifting ground that cause bellies and breaks. Desert trees (mesquite, olive) send roots into sewer lines for water. A camera shows exactly what is in your line so you can clear, repair, or plan replacement before a backup happens.
